Elevator Door Motor YBP80-6Y46Y2: Stable Power Core from Nanjing Zhuye Elevatorparts
Elevator Door Motor YBP80-6Y46Y2 is a dedicated power component engineered for elevator door operator systems, responsible for providing continuous, stable, and precise driving force for the opening and closing of elevator car doors and landing doors. As the “power heart” of the elevator door system, it converts electrical energy into mechanical energy with high efficiency, cooperating seamlessly with door operator controllers, encoders, and other components to achieve smooth, quiet, and rapid door operation—directly determining passenger ride comfort and the overall reliability of the elevator door system. Exclusively supplied by Nanjing Zhuye Elevatorparts, a professional and trusted provider of high-quality elevator electrical components, theElevator Door Motor YBP80-6Y46Y2 fully complies with international elevator safety standards (EN 81-20, GB 7588) and motor technical regulations (IEC 60034). With excellent torque performance, low energy consumption, and broad compatibility with mainstream elevator door operator models, this motor is widely utilized in residential buildings, commercial complexes, high-speed elevators, and industrial elevators worldwide.

Each unit undergoes a multi-stage pre-delivery inspection protocol, including torque performance testing, speed stability verification, noise level measurement, and temperature rise detection. The motor adopts advanced structural design and premium materials: high-purity copper windings with optimized winding technology ensure low resistance, strong rated torque output, and excellent energy-saving performance; high-precision sealed bearings reduce operational friction, minimizing noise (operation noise ≤ 58dB) and extending service life; a lightweight aluminum alloy housing with enhanced heat dissipation fins effectively controls temperature rise (temperature rise ≤ 75K) during long-term continuous operation; the built-in thermal overload protection device automatically cuts off power when the motor overheats, preventing burnout and ensuring operational safety. With standardized mounting dimensions and interface specifications, the YBP80-6Y46Y2 motor allows for quick and seamless installation, eliminating the need for complex modifications to existing door operator systems.
Step-by-Step Usage Guide for Elevator Door Motor YBP80-6Y46Y2
To maximize the performance and service life of the Elevator Door Motor YBP80-6Y46Y2, and to ensure the safe and reliable operation of the elevator door system, strictly follow the professional guidelines provided by Nanjing Zhuye Elevatorparts for installation, debugging, and maintenance:
1. Professional Installation & Wiring
Installation must be conducted by certified elevator technicians proficient in elevator door operator systems. Prior to installation, use the detailed compatibility manual provided by Nanjing Zhuye Elevatorparts to confirm that the YBP80-6Y46Y2 motor is compatible with the target elevator’s door operator model, power parameters, and control system. The installation steps are as follows:
-
Safety Preparation: Cut off the elevator’s main power supply and the dedicated power supply of the door operator system. Lock the power switch to prevent accidental power-on. Clean the motor mounting position on the door operator bracket to remove dust, oil stains, and debris that may affect installation accuracy and heat dissipation.
-
Motor Installation: Fix the YBP80-6Y46Y2 motor to the dedicated mounting bracket using high-strength bolts provided by Nanjing Zhuye Elevatorparts. Ensure the motor is installed horizontally (horizontal deviation ≤ 1mm) and the output shaft is coaxial with the door operator transmission mechanism (coaxiality deviation ≤ 0.1mm) to avoid abnormal wear and noise. Connect the motor output shaft to the reducer or belt pulley, ensuring a tight fit without slipping or loosening.
-
Wiring Operation: In accordance with the elevator door operator system wiring diagram, connect the motor’s power cable (three-phase or single-phase, depending on the model) and control cable to the corresponding interfaces of the door operator controller. Ensure correct wiring polarity, tight terminal connections, and reliable insulation. Use cable ties to neatly fix the cables, avoiding contact with moving parts of the door system or high-voltage components to reduce electromagnetic interference. Confirm that the motor’s rated voltage and frequency match the controller’s output parameters.
-
Post-Installation Debugging: Restore the power supply and switch the elevator to inspection mode. Activate the door opening/closing function and adjust the motor’s operating parameters (speed, acceleration/deceleration time) through the controller to match the elevator’s door system requirements. Observe the door operation process to confirm smooth opening and closing, no jitter or stuck phenomena, and the noise level meets the standard. Use a tachometer to verify the motor’s actual operating speed is consistent with the set value, and check the motor surface temperature after 30 minutes of continuous operation (normal temperature ≤ 95℃).
2. Daily Operation & Routine Inspection
Regular inspections and maintenance are essential to early fault detection and ensuring the long-term stable operation of the YBP80-6Y46Y2 motor. Maintenance personnel should integrate the following checks into their daily patrol routines:
-
Daily Visual Inspection: During door operator patrols, check the external condition of the YBP80-6Y46Y2 motor. Ensure the aluminum alloy housing is free of deformation, cracks, or corrosion; the power cable and control cable are intact without aging, wear, or loose connections; the mounting bolts are tight without looseness. Observe the door operation to check for abnormal phenomena (e.g., slow door opening/closing, obvious jitter, unusual friction noise) that may indicate motor faults.
-
Weekly Performance Check: Use a multimeter to detect the motor’s input voltage and current, ensuring they are within the rated range. Measure the motor surface temperature after peak operation hours to confirm no abnormal overheating. Check the tightness of the output shaft connection and re-tighten if there is any looseness. Record the operating parameters for trend analysis and troubleshooting.
-
Monthly Cleaning & Lubrication: Clean the motor housing and heat dissipation fins with a soft, dry cloth to remove dust and debris, ensuring good heat dissipation. For motors with lubrication points (as specified in the manual), apply a small amount of special lubricating grease (recommended by Nanjing Zhuye Elevatorparts) to the bearings to reduce friction and extend service life. Avoid lubricant contamination on the motor windings or electrical connections.
Recommended Replacement Cycle for Elevator Door Motor YBP80-6Y46Y2
As a core power component, the Elevator Door Motor YBP80-6Y46Y2 endures long-term load operation, frequent start-stop cycles, and environmental erosion (humidity, dust, vibration of the door operator). Over time, these factors can lead to component aging, such as winding insulation degradation, bearing wear, and brush wear (if applicable), resulting in performance degradation. Timely replacement is critical to avoiding faults such as reduced torque output, increased noise, abnormal overheating, or complete motor burnout—issues that may cause door opening/closing failure, stuck doors, or even affect the normal operation of the elevator.
1. Standard Replacement Cycle
Under normal operating conditions (elevator daily operation time 12–24 hours, daily door opening/closing cycles ≥ 1500, environment temperature -10–60℃, humidity 10%–95%), the recommended replacement cycle for the Elevator Door Motor YBP80-6Y46Y2 is 5–6 years. This cycle is determined based on Nanjing Zhuye Elevatorparts’ long-term field operation data, motor component aging tests, and global user feedback on elevator door operator systems.
2. Adjustments for Special Scenarios
-
Harsh Environments & High-Traffic Scenarios: For elevators in high-humidity coastal areas (salt spray corrosion), high-dust construction sites, or high-traffic areas (e.g., shopping malls, airports) with daily door opening/closing cycles ≥ 3000, the replacement cycle should be shortened to 3–4 years. Harsh conditions and frequent use accelerate motor winding aging, bearing wear, and housing corrosion, significantly reducing the motor’s reliability and service life.
-
Low-Frequency Use Scenarios: For elevators with low usage frequency (e.g., villa elevators, small office buildings with daily operation time < 8 hours) and stable door operator environments, the replacement cycle can be extended to 6–7 years—only if Nanjing Zhuye Elevatorparts’ professional technicians conduct an inspection and confirm that the motor’s torque performance, speed stability, and temperature rise are intact and consistent with original factory standards.
3. Immediate Replacement Conditions
Replace the Elevator Door Motor YBP80-6Y46Y2 immediately if any of the following issues occur, regardless of its service life:
-
The motor has insufficient torque, leading to slow door opening/closing, difficulty in opening heavy doors, or frequent stalling during operation, and the fault persists after controller parameter adjustment.
-
The motor operates with abnormal noise (e.g., sharp friction sound, heavy vibration noise) or overheats rapidly (surface temperature exceeds 120℃ within 10 minutes of operation), indicating internal bearing damage or winding insulation failure.
-
The motor fails to start or has intermittent operation, and the fault is confirmed to be caused by internal winding burnout, rotor damage, or brush wear (if applicable) after professional testing.
-
The motor fails the performance test (e.g., rated torque deviation exceeds ±10%, speed fluctuation exceeds ±5%), failing to meet the elevator door operator system’s power requirements.
